QUOTE(Fortunatus @ Jan 23 2014, 10:32 AM)
Hi guys, need some advice.

I bought m14x R1 3 years ago, and now thinking of upgrading my system..

Should i consider the new m14x or just desktop x51...?

i would like to play witcher 3 & dragon age 3  in the future with high setting and full hd....
is m14x sufficient? my r1 cant even run witcher 2 properly...
*
The obvious answer is no. It won't be sufficient at all. What u probably need is a laptop which has GTX 770M or 780M just to get it running at that level of detail and resolution. That's only ensuring that it can run. Smooth or not, that's another question. The best is getting a SLI capable desktop which will be able to run a lot of games smoothly. That way, u don't need to worry much. If u don't have that budget, then u can go for high end single GPU desktop PC. That works as well. Mobile gaming is still a bit underpower IMO.
